Data Science Meets Sideline Strategy: UConn's Game-Changing Internship Unleashes Student Talent

Sports
2025-04-08 07:30:23

Since its inception two years ago, the Sports Statistics Experiential Learning Program has rapidly expanded, now collaborating with 12 different UConn athletic programs. What began as a promising initiative has blossomed into a comprehensive opportunity for students to gain hands-on experience in sports analytics, bridging the gap between academic learning and real-world athletic performance analysis. Gators Shock Cougars: Florida's Dramatic Last-Minute Triumph Clinches National Crown

Sports
2025-04-08 05:01:21

In a thrilling championship showdown, the Florida Gators etched their name in basketball history by staging a remarkable comeback to clinch their first national title since 2007. The team's gritty performance captivated fans and analysts alike, with Yahoo Sports' Jason Fitz and former Big 12 Player of the Year Marcus Morris Sr. breaking down the Gators' incredible victory. Facing a daunting 12-point deficit in the second half, the Gators refused to surrender. Their resilience and determination shone through as they methodically chipped away at the Cougars' lead, ultimately emerging victorious with a nail-biting 65-63 win. The dramatic turnaround not only secured the championship but also reignited the program's winning legacy. The game was a testament to the Gators' mental toughness and strategic prowess, proving that championship teams are defined by their ability to perform under pressure. As the final buzzer sounded, Florida celebrated a momentous return to national glory, reminding everyone why March Madness continues to be one of the most exciting sporting events in America. MORE...
